3. Historical Importance in Cannabinoid Science
CP-47,497 is frequently cited as a milestone compound in cannabinoid research. Its development proved that cannabinoid receptor activation was not limited to THC-like dibenzopyran structures, influencing decades of medicinal chemistry.
Historically, CP-47,497 contributed to:
Expansion of classical cannabinoid SAR models
Validation of CB1 receptor binding outside THC analogs
Comparative studies with HU-210 and CP-55,940
Early forensic identification frameworks
Because of this, CP-47,497 remains a reference standard in cannabinoid receptor education and toxicology retrospectives.
